Handover: Brokkr message broker upgrade (Marit → Olavsen)

We're midway through upgrading Brokkr from 4.2 to 5.0 on the Tindevik cluster. The staging nodes are already on 5.0 and have run clean for ten days. Production still runs 4.2; do not flip the feature flag until consumer lag on the billing topic stays under five seconds for a full day. Watch the retention settings carefully — 5.0 changed the defaults. The current production values are listed below.

settings of yahag-yafog:
[pramir]
host = pramir.qirvancorp.internal
user = pramir_svc
database = pramir_prod

Vramscope persists GPU memory snapshots in three places. Raw allocation traces go to the Kestrelbin object store, retention 14 days. Aggregated per-kernel stats land in the rollup warehouse, refreshed hourly. Plugin authors should never write to either directly; use the ingest API.

Session metadata (device IDs, driver versions, capture flags) lives in a small relational store. Read-only replicas are available for plugin queries. To query session metadata from your plugin's test harness, connect using the following string.

primary connection of yagep-kahip = redis://giliel_svc:zYiKsLL2PLpfPL@db-348f.xolmarsys.corp:5432/fenwyn

Subject: TrailNote offline-mode cut-over — summary

Team, the cut-over for TrailNote's offline mode completed Sunday night. Field surveyors now get a local queue that syncs when connectivity returns; the old always-online endpoints are retired. We validated conflict resolution against three weeks of replayed survey data from the Kelvane pilot. Future maintainers: the sync daemon is the only component with environment-specific tuning. The production service now runs with the following configuration values.

settings of tajeg-fahap:
quenael:
  log_level: debug
  metrics_host: metrics.quenael.zemvarlabs.internal
  pin: 8863
  pool_size: 16

Subject: Tax cache cut-over done

Hey Priya,

Quick recap: we flipped the Lumenrate tax-rate lookup cache over to the new Hollyvane cluster last night. Hit rates look great (~94%), and the stale-entry sweeper is behaving. Old cache stays read-only until Friday, then we tear it down. One thing to double-check in your review: TTLs. Here are the config values the service booted with:

config for tagep-yajef:
ulawyn:
  log_level: error
  metrics_host: metrics.ulawyn.lumiclabs.internal
  pin: 0564
  pool_size: 32